Can the AMD RX 580 (4GB) run World of Tanks? (2026)

Yes
~65 FPS at 1080p with optimized settings

The AMD RX 580 (4GB) is a entry-level card with 4GB of VRAM, and World of Tanks is a relatively light game to run. Paired with a balanced Intel Core i5-8600K-class CPU it averages about 65 FPS at 1080p with FrameCoach's tuned settings — up from roughly 65 FPS with everything on High.

ResolutionAll-High FPSOptimized FPS
1080p6565
1440p3961
4K2252
💡 World of Tanks: Scales down to very modest hardware; lower Foliage first - it also stops bushes hiding enemy tanks.

At 1080p expect around 65 FPS, at 1440p about 61 FPS, and at 4K roughly 52 FPS with optimized settings. World of Tanks doesn't use upscaling, so the gains come from trimming the heaviest settings.
